Product details

Madeline Young was one of Australia's leading jazz guitarists whose life ended tragically; another victim of manic depression. At 25 she was already established with her own trio playing Sydney's pub and club circuit and had played alongside artists such as James Morrison and Don Burrows. She was well known to the composer especially in her early years when she was still studying the classical guitar at the Sydney Conservatorium. I have fond memories of jamming with her and being really touched by her great passion for music.

— R. Charlton, 1998
